  1. Bromsgrove School has boarding and day students and consists of three schools, pre-prep nursery school (ages 2 – 7), preparatory school (ages 7 – 13) and the senior school (13 – 18). The school has a total of 200 teaching staff, with 1,660 pupils, including 220 in the pre-preparatory school, 500 in the preparatory School and 940 in the senior school, of whom 60% are male and 40% female ...

  3. Bromsgrove School. Bromsgrove School ist ein koedukatives Internat in Bromsgrove in der englischen Grafschaft Worcestershire. Gegründet im Jahre 1553, gilt sie als eine der renommiertesten und ältesten Privatschulen des Landes. Die Schule wird von 944 Schülern besucht, davon 55 % Internatsschüler und 20 % internationale Schüler.

  6. Admission to Bromsgrove School. Pupils may gain admission to Bromsgrove School in most year groups. Main intake points are at Kindergarten, 7+, 11+, 13+ and 16+. Admissions in the course of an academic year are by special arrangement with the Assistant Head (Admissions) and entry into Year 10 is not normally possible due to curriculum constraints.
